Enhancing Precision: How Optical Navigation increases Surgical results

Precision is vital in surgeries, as even the slightest deviation may lead to undesired results. Optical navigation programs supply surgeons with unparalleled precision, ensuring the highest level of precision necessary for complex techniques. These units work through the use of close to-infrared light to detect reflective markers on surgical devices. by triangulation, the markers’ actual situation is calculated in 3D coordinates, which lets genuine-time monitoring for the duration of techniques. as an example, in orthopedics and neurosurgery, where by millimeter-amount precision matters most, optical navigation minimizes faults and supports essential selection-creating. The Highly developed positioning precision of nearly 0.08mm RMS offered by AIMOOE’s optical monitoring systems ensures surgical resources are exactly aligned, leaving small room for troubles. By lowering the potential risk of human mistake, these units empower surgeons to achieve constantly greater results for their individuals.

Real-Time opinions: great things about Optical Tracking in Dynamic Surgical Environments

Dynamic surgical environments normally call for rapid selections based upon actual-time facts. the power of optical monitoring devices to provide speedy suggestions is an indispensable benefit. meant to function using a significant sampling frequency of nearly 300Hz, these programs procedure data in true time, guaranteeing that surgeons are equipped with the most accurate and up-to-date information and facts all over the treatment. For example, AIMOOE’s Optical Positioning Camera utilizes wireless conversation to mail marker-based mostly comments on to the program interface. This fast info transfer improves responsiveness during intricate surgeries, where by conditions could shift speedily. Whether it’s guiding robotic arms or altering surgical instruments, optical tracking devices permit an clever, adaptive approach to surgical procedures, guaranteeing precision and efficiency below dynamic disorders.
